nice one,how do you set the floating anchor for footlocking?like the ropeguide retrival one,doesnt it get tangled up whilst working?not as good as a double snapper tho.......:001_cool:

Posted
nice one,how do you set the floating anchor for footlocking?like the ropeguide retrival one,doesnt it get tangled up whilst working?not as good as a double snapper tho.......:001_cool:

 

hey adam, tie an alpine butterfly or inline fi8 into both lines below your footlock prussic and clip your carabiners/revolvers into those.make sense?

You only tie the tail to the rope (on the rg retrieval) over the branch when your about to descend out of the tree, i put them close just for the photo. sorry bout that bud.

just make sure your footlock prussic bites, then sit in your harness and tie the knots midline below your prussic. gotta tie into both lines remember:thumbup:

Donr forget you can remove the karabiners from the ground before pulling the line out completely. Nothing worse than getting a biner stuck in the crotch with the other end of the line off the ground and unreachable!
